Police in Glasgow Project Giant Image to Catch a Killer

From the BBC:

A 60ft high picture of a
murdered prostitute has been projected onto a derelict block of flats in
Glasgow.

Detectives hope it will help to turn up clues about the
death of Emma Caldwell, whose body was found in woods in South Lanarkshire on 8
May.

The image was displayed for four hours on the multi-storey flats
in Cumberland Street, Hutchesontown on Monday night.

Police said the
site had been chosen as it was visible across areas frequented by Emma and other
prostitutes.

The picture, which shows Ms Caldwell half smiling but
looking gaunt on a family day out in the countryside, was released by police
last week.

Detective Superintendent Willie Johnstone, who is leading
the investigation, said: “This is an innovative way of putting a fresh appeal
over to the public and it will be very eye-catching.

‘Vital
information’

“Someone out there know something and people who see
this may be able to provide that vital piece of information that could solve the
case.

“As far as we are aware, this is the first time that a law
enforcement agency in the United Kingdom has used this type of appeal.”

/>Emma was last seen on 4 April walking in Butterbiggins Road, Govanhill. She
had been living in a women’s hostel in the area
